Air-Ships Based High-Altitude Pseudo-Satellite (AS-HAPS)
Why in News?
- The Defence Acquisition Council (DAC) recently granted Acceptance of Necessity (AoN) for AS-HAPS procurement for the Indian Air Force, part of a βΉ3.60 lakh crore package including Rafale jets.β
- Estimated at βΉ15,000 crore, it boosts Intelligence, Surveillance, and Reconnaissance (ISR) amid border tensions.
Key Information and Features
- Altitude & Endurance: These platforms operate in the stratosphere at altitudes of 18–20 km (roughly 65,000 feet), which is nearly double the cruising altitude of commercial planes. They are designed to stay airborne for months or even years.
- Solar Powered: AS-HAPS utilizes solar energy during the day and high-density rechargeable batteries at night, enabling perpetual flight without the need for traditional fuel.
- "Towers in the Sky": Because they hover persistently over a specific geographic location (unlike satellites that orbit at high speeds), they function as aerial base stations for communication and monitoring.
- Cost Efficiency: Operating HAPS is significantly cheaper than conventional satellites because they do not require expensive rocket launches and can be retrieved for maintenance or payload upgrades.
- Indigenous Development: India has been developing these systems through the CSIR-National Aerospace Laboratories (NAL) in Bengaluru. A 12-metre wingspan prototype successfully completed test flights in early 2024, and a full-scale version with a 30-metre wingspan is planned for 2027.
Primary Applications
- Military & Defense:
- Persistent ISR: Intelligence, Surveillance, and Reconnaissance across 15,000 km of land borders and 7,500 km of coastline.
- ELINT: Electronic Intelligence gathering and target tracking.
- Missile Detection: Early warning systems for incoming threats.
- Civilian & Humanitarian:
- Telecom Relay: Providing 5G connectivity and high-speed internet to remote, underserved, or disaster-hit areas.
- Disaster Management: Real-time damage assessment and emergency communication nodes.
- Environmental Monitoring: Precision agriculture, maritime patrol, and tracking climate changes or forest fires.
